Egan-jones

Egan-Jones is a prominent credit rating agency that provides independent ratings and research on corporate and sovereign debt issuers. Founded in 1995, the company distinguishes itself by being investor-funded rather than issuer-paid, which aims to reduce conflicts of interest and enhance the objectivity of its ratings. Egan-Jones generates revenue through subscription services and fees for its research and analysis. A significant aspect of its history is its role in advocating for reforms in the credit rating industry, particularly following the 2008 financial crisis. The firm is known for its proactive approach in identifying credit risks, often issuing early warnings on financial downturns.
